Officially launched on October 14, the “Section 301 investigation” comes at a time of intensifying global shipbuilding competition and frequent geopolitical factors. What are the immediate concerns and long-term considerations for Chinese shipyards?

Initial Phase of Investigation Release Puts Pressure on Chinese Shipyards’ Market Share

As a significant move by the United States utilizing unilateral trade tools targeting specific Chinese industries, the initiation of this “Section 301 investigation” has been interpreted by external observers as a key step attempting to curb the international competitiveness of China’s shipbuilding industry. The investigation comprises five annexes in total, among which Annex II “Fee on Vessel Operators for Vessels Built in the People’s Republic of China” (“Annex II”) is widely regarded within the industry as likely to have a substantial impact on the Chinese shipbuilding market, due to its direct relevance to the overseas business布局 (layout) and vessel operating costs of Chinese shipbuilding enterprises. Consequently, it has become the most watched content of this “Section 301 investigation”.

According to Annex II, starting October 14, 2025, all vessels built in China but operated by non-Chinese operators (except for specific exempted circumstances) will be required to pay an additional fee each time they enter a U.S. port. The fee calculation adopts a “select the higher amount” principle, meaning the fee is levied based on whichever standard yields the higher amount: the vessel’s net tonnage or the number of containers discharged. The per-ton fee starts at $18/net ton, increasing annually, and will rise to $33/net ton by 2028, representing an increase of nearly 84% over four years. The per-container fee starts at $120 per container, also increasing annually, and will reach $250 per container by 2028, an increase of over 108%. In terms of vessel types, container ships, whose cargo is measured in standard containers, are typically charged based on the per-container standard, while bulk carriers, for which deadweight tonnage is a core indicator, are generally charged based on the per-ton standard. The core objective of the U.S. in implementing this fee is to reduce the attractiveness of Chinese-built vessels in the international shipping market by increasing the costs for non-Chinese operators using “China-built” vessels, thereby diverting overseas orders that would otherwise go to Chinese shipyards. To balance domestic U.S. interests and the needs of specific industries, Annex II also includes a series of exemption clauses, specifically including: Vessels owned and controlled at a level of 75% or more by U.S. companies are exempt, as they directly relate to the interests of U.S. domestic enterprises; Vessels entering U.S. ports in ballast or empty, as they do not involve actual cargo transportation, are temporarily not subject to the additional fee; Small and medium-sized vessels (e.g., container ships with a capacity ≤ 4000 TEU), considering their smaller operational scale and limited impact on the overall market, are also included in the exemption scope; Vessels operating on short-sea routes with voyages less than 2000 nautical miles, as they primarily serve regional shipping and have lower relevance to deep-sea market competition, are also excluded from the fee; Furthermore, specialized chemical tankers, as a special vessel type in a niche segment, and vessels participating in the U.S. Defense Strategic Sea Transportation Plan, are also eligible for exemptions due to industry specificity and national security considerations. Although these exemption clauses aim to protect U.S. domestic interests and specific niche industries, from an overall perspective, most China-built vessels engaged in deep-sea shipping are still included in the fee scope, making it difficult to avoid the additional cost pressure.

In the initial phase following the release of the “Section 301 investigation,” its restrictive clauses targeting “China-built vessels” quickly triggered a chain reaction in the global newbuilding market. Overseas shipowners began adjusting their order strategies based on cost expectations and risk assessments, posing significant pressure on Chinese shipyards in securing overseas orders. Among these, U.S. energy giant ExxonMobil, as a major global demand source for energy shipping, explicitly cited both political factors and economic costs as reasons and directly canceled its previous order for 2 large LNG bunkering vessels placed with Chinese shipyards. This decision not only disrupted the short-term production plans of the relevant Chinese shipyards but also sent a cautious signal to the market regarding “China-built” vessels; The NYSE-listed tanker company DHT, focusing on cost control and operational stability, chose to sell 2 China-built VLCCs from its fleet and adjusted its fleet structure to retain only 21 South Korea-built vessels, further highlighting some shipowners’ concerns about the increased subsequent operating costs of China-built vessels; Capital Group, owned by Greek shipowner Evangelos Marinakis, also signed a Letter of Intent with South Korea’s Hanwha Ocean for the construction of 2+1 320,000 DWT VLCCs. This marks the group’s first return to a South Korean shipyard for cooperation in nearly three years, with the stated reason being “risk diversification,” indirectly reflecting the impact of the “Section 301 investigation” on shipowners’ cooperation decisions. Statistics from the international shipping consultancy Clarksons further corroborate this trend. The data shows that as of the end of July this year, the number of new orders placed by non-Chinese shipowners at Chinese shipyards was only 398 vessels (excluding option orders), compared to 1,198 vessels in the same period of 2024, a sharp decrease of two-thirds year-on-year.

Not long ago, the three core shipbuilding data points for the first half of this year released by the China Association of the National Shipbuilding Industry (CANSI) also reflect the changing dynamics between current market热度 (/activity) and future new demand. Specifically, the national ship completion volume in the first half was 24.13 million DWT. Although this still represents a high production scale, it decreased by 3.5% year-on-year, indicating that the industry’s production rhythm has been somewhat affected by changes in external orders; The volume of new orders received was 44.33 million DWT, a year-on-year decrease of 18.2%, confirming the slowdown in new industry demand; Meanwhile, the volume of手持 orders (order backlog) reached 234.54 million DWT, a year-on-year increase of 36.7%, making it the only indicator among the three to show a year-on-year increase. This is mainly attributable to the order reserves accumulated by Chinese shipbuilding enterprises relying on their technical strength and cost advantages during the previous period, providing support for the short-term stable operation of the industry. Between the comparison of these two declining and one rising core data points, a gap is隐约可见 (faintly visible) between the current market热度 (heat) sustained by the order backlog and the potential for future new demand to continue slowing down.

Hot Sales of Feeder Ships Reflect Shipyards’ “Immediate Concern” for Order Resilience

Industry experts told this publication that the impact of the “Section 301 investigation” on Chinese shipyards is concentrated in the large container ship segment: on one hand, shipping from China to the U.S. primarily relies on large container ships of 8000 TEU and above; on the other hand, as mentioned above, container ships of 4000 TEU and below are exempt from the fee.

According to Clarksons data, in the first nine months of this year, new orders for large container ships (above 4000 TEU) at major Chinese shipyards generally declined, while new orders for container ships of 4000 TEU and below generally increased (see Table 1).

Specifically, Huangpu Wenchong’s order intake surged from 8 small feeder ships in 2024 to 22 ships, but orders for medium and large container ships declined, with 16 secured in 2024 and only 10 in the first nine months of this year; Xin Yangzi Shipbuilding, under Yangzijiang Shipbuilding, which had zero orders in the ≤4000 TEU segment last year, signed 26 ships in one go this year; China Merchants Industry’s Nanjing Jinling Shipyard, which had zero small feeder orders last year, has received orders for 8 ships this year.

As stated above, while feeder ship orders were rapidly filled, the growth in orders for the >4000 TEU segment at Chinese shipyards noticeably slowed. For instance, Hengli Heavy Industry received 20 orders last year, but only accumulated 12 orders in the first nine months of this year, all placed by Mediterranean Shipping Company (MSC). State-owned shipyards performed relatively steadily in securing large container ship orders. Last year, Jiangnan Shipyard and Waigaoqiao Shipbuilding secured 13 and 18 orders respectively, and have already secured 12 and 16 orders in the first nine months of this year. Nanjing Jinling Shipyard did not receive any large container ship orders last year but has secured 4 orders in the first nine months of this year.

Compared to Chinese shipyards, the order intake for large container ships at South Korea’s three major shipyards significantly increased in the first nine months of this year.

Why has the growth in large container ship orders “decelerated” in the Chinese market? Several interviewed shipyard executives provided three explanations: First, the super cycle from 2021–2023透支 demand, with global orderbooks already covering until 2028, leading to strong wait-and-see sentiment among shipowners; Second, the capacity of key Chinese shipyards is saturated, berth schedules are tight, and room for price negotiation has narrowed, forcing some orders to flow elsewhere; Third, although the “Section 301 investigation” does not directly target ships, foreign shipowners, to avoid potential political risks, tend to shift high-value-added ship types to South Korea and Japan for construction. As the “customers” of private shipyards are mostly foreign shipowners, they are significantly affected. In contrast, feeder ships are not affected by the “301 investigation,” and coupled with the increase in intra-regional trade in Southeast Asia and adjustments to the port rotation sequence of “large ship + small ship” combinations on US routes, demand has been ignited. Chinese shipyards, leveraging cost and delivery advantages, have become the biggest beneficiaries.

Cost advantages remain the strongest confidence for Chinese shipyards. Industry experts state that, taking large container ships as an example, although newbuilding market prices have currently fallen by 7%–8%, Chinese shipyards still maintain considerable profits, primarily because Chinese steel plate prices are more than 50% lower than those in Japan and South Korea, combined with the advantage of the RMB exchange rate, keeping Chinese shipyards’ newbuilding quotes competitive. On the efficiency front: Shipyards are actively implementing digital and intelligent transformation to improve production efficiency, aiding “on-time delivery.” Through digital and intelligent transformation, Xin Yangzi Shipyard basically delivers 1–2 more ships annually than planned. New Times Shipbuilding, through intelligent upgrades in pipeline fabrication, flat panel line flow, and workshop automated production, has reduced operational costs by at least 10%. Its current annual capacity is about 30 ships, and annual deliveries are expected to reach 45 ships in two years. More crucially is delivery credibility – CSSC Chengxi Shipyard’s MR tanker “CAPE BILBAO” was delivered 105 days ahead of the contract date, Mawei Shipbuilding’s 7500-car LNG dual-fuel Ro-Ro ship was delivered 4 months early, and Chuandong Shipbuilding’s 11500-ton stainless steel chemical tanker “Jin Hai Cheng” achieved its delivery target 3 days early. A series of “early deliveries” have kept foreign shipowners’ confidence in Chinese manufacturing at a high level.

Industry experts believe that, from a market perspective, the marginal impact of the “301 investigation” is diminishing. Approximately 15% of global merchant ships need to call at US ports, while only 4% of ships serving US routes are built in China. This significant disparity means limited room for “choking.” Combined with Chinese shipyards having complete supply chains in mainstream ship types, offering advantageous prices and passing technical standards, they remain attractive to shipowners. This publication found through Clarksons data that this year, top liner companies such as MSC, CMA CGM, Seaspan, and several Greek shipowners continue to place orders at Chinese shipyards. Insiders also revealed that although some shipyards have not received large container ship orders so far, there might be breakthroughs by year-end, as top liner companies are actively negotiating with them.

Heads of several leading shipyards told this publication that, regardless of external challenges, the current focus of their companies is actively considering how to leverage competitiveness, maintain order resilience, deliver on time with quality, and protect their international reputation.

Amidst multiple challenges, shipyards plan for the long term with “future concerns.”

With order production schedules generally extending to 2028 or even 2030, the “immediate worries” of Chinese shipyards seem temporarily alleviated. Industry insiders warn that the international situation is changing rapidly, and the global shipbuilding cycle may peak and decline within 3 years. How to secure orders beyond 2028 and how to avoid the current capacity expansion backfiring on performance when future demand falls have become “future concerns” that must be faced directly. Shipyard experts interviewed by this publication unanimously stated that being prepared for danger in times of safety centers on cash flow security, and extreme caution is needed regarding capacity expansion; currently, the state implements total quantity control on new shipbuilding docks based on “production determined by sales,” mainly approving projects with full production loads, aiming to prevent a new round of overcapacity.

Based on the inherent replacement demand of ships (container ships typically have a service life of 15 years) and green regulations accelerating the phase-out of aging capacity, shipbuilding demand will not disappear, but the structure will significantly shift towards greening and intelligence; regarding the choice of new energy ship routes, the commercialization pace of methanol and ammonia is lower than expected, and LNG power is still considered the most realistic choice in the transition stage. Companies generally plan to flexibly adjust their product mix based on market signals, prioritizing locking in green ship orders, while simultaneously strengthening buyer default handling clauses in contracts to prevent the dual pressure of “low-price order grabbing” and “contract cancellation and ship abandonment” during a downturn. Experts particularly pointed out that if zombie capacity revives during this boom period, it could easily trigger a price war in the next downturn. Regulatory authorities should intervene early, setting capacity red lines参照 the automotive industry’s practices, to avoid internal卷 within the industry.

Looking overseas, potential competitors like India, Vietnam, and the US are making multi-pronged efforts through government backing, capital subsidies, and international technical cooperation, attempting to carve out a share in the Asian shipbuilding landscape. As of September this year, although Indian shipyards have not yet entered Clarksons’ container ship order ranking, the country has a clear development plan: establish a state-owned liner company by 2030, achieve a 50% domestic production rate for container ships by 2035, and increase the Indian fleet’s global share to 20% by 2047; the FY2025 budget allocated $3 billion in a one-time allocation to establish a “Maritime Development Fund,” with 49% earmarked to subsidize domestic shipowners placing orders at Indian shipyards.

Capital and technology introduction are also advancing simultaneously: Maersk is cooperating with Cochin Shipyard to build a green ship repair and R&D center, MSC plans to partner with Swan Defence to build a shipbuilding base, and the CMA CGM Group has included the Nhava Sheva port hub project in its India-Middle East route planning; NYK Line, Hyundai Heavy Industries, and Samsung Heavy Industries have also inspected Indian coasts to assess the feasibility of joint ventures. However, the shortcomings of India’s shipbuilding industry are also evident – insufficient large dock capacity and a localization rate of supporting industries below 30%, meaning India can only play a “substitute” role in the short term, but its policy endurance and financial resources should not be underestimated.

Regarding Vietnam, it maintained growth momentum in 2024. The 65,000 DWT bulk carrier delivered by SBIC’s Nam Trieu Shipbuilding set a national record for the largest ship built. According to development plans, the Vietnamese fleet size will expand to 1,600–1,750 ships, with a total capacity of 17–18 million DWT, including 1,200 ocean-going ships with a capacity of 13–14 million DWT. The replacement demand from an aging fleet is directly converted into orders for local shipyards. UNCTAD data shows that Vietnam ranks 7th among the top 15 global shipbuilding countries, with 88 shipbuilding enterprises and 411 inland construction facilities, an annual capacity of 2.6 million DWT, and an average annual growth rate of new ship demand of about 10% from 2023–2030, with total annual demand of 4–5 million DWT.

Vietnam has identified the marine economy as the core engine for industrialization and modernization, planning to utilize its north-south coastline resources to undertake export ship orders, while attracting international supporting enterprises to establish presence, compensating for the severe reliance on imported raw materials. Experts judge that Vietnam’s labor costs and geographical通道 possess competitive advantages; if sustained investment continues, it could pose a partial challenge to China in 10–15 years.

The US market is also sending subtle signals: In July this year, South Korea’s HD Hyundai Group signed an agreement with local shipowner Edison Chouest Offshore to build LNG dual-fuel medium-sized container ships at Tampa Ship starting in 2028, marking the first time in nearly a decade that a US shipyard has returned to the merchant ship order stage. ECO and Bollinger Shipyards have jointly formed the “American Shipbuilding Consortium,” targeting high-value-added ship types like icebreakers, naval auxiliary ships, and crane vessels. HD Hyundai provides design, equipment procurement, and block manufacturing support, intending to leverage US domestic capacity through a “technology + capital” approach. Although the US shipbuilding scale accounts for less than 1% of the global total, driven by policy and energy transition needs, it may become a “small but refined” supplier of high-end special vessels in the future.

Based on comprehensive research from various sources, the industry generally believes that India, Vietnam, and the US will find it difficult to shake China’s overall shipbuilding advantages in the short term. However, their government-led, capital-intensive, and technologically encircling approach suggests that the next stage of competition will focus on green rule-making and strategic capacity control, beyond just cost, efficiency, and industrial chain depth.

From policy impact to proactive response, China’s shipbuilding industry is experiencing the growing pains of transitioning from short-term pressure to long-term upgrading. Although the additional fee policy has caused order fluctuations, it has also forced the industry to accelerate its departure from the scale expansion model towards a new path of technology-driven and high-quality development. Relying on the short-term buffer of the orderbook, combined with long-term布局 for technological breakthroughs and market diversification, China’s shipbuilding industry is not only expected to withstand the impact of unilateral trade barriers but also to consolidate its competitive advantages in the global shipbuilding industry’s green transformation and technological innovation, contributing Chinese strength to the stable development of the global shipping industry.
